> > False.  Option B is multi-user safe, period.  The reason is that
> > currval returns the value last obtained by nextval *in your own
> > session*, independently of what anyone else has done meanwhile.
>
> What do you understand for *session* ? Same postgres
> connection ? Same ADO connection ? (ADO sometimes make more
> than one connection for recordset)
>
> How Can I know how many connections are active ?
> (for ADO debugging)

I don't think you can easily find out what connections are open (at least
from the ADO end). In pgAdmin II there is a long running bug that I can't
resolve that prevents dropping a database because I can't persuade *all*
connections to the specified database to close.

It's for this reason that I'd still use option A - option B may be multi
user safe (now that I understand it properly :-) ) but you never know  how
ADO is going to handle it. In theory it should only use one connection but
the bug I mention above (knowing the time, effort and experimentation I've
put into fixing it) makes me wonder.
